RB Murray Returns To Cowboys After Injury
ARLINGTON (AP) The wait is over for running back DeMarco Murray and the Dallas Cowboys.
The third-round draft pick made his practice debut Tuesday, coming back for the first time since straining a hamstring during the lockout.
The Cowboys also welcomed back fellow running back Tashard Choice (calf), wide receiver Miles Austin (hamstring) and linebacker Keith Brooking.
Murray is the third-string back behind starter Felix Jones and Choice, but the rookie figures to play a significant role in the offense. Coach Jason Garrett says he thinks Murray can be an every-down back, catch out of the backfield, protect the quarterback and return kicks.
